Output 30156c6f8aa69438d4c9c0913834b5977e89694e50e7215b8cbdd6549fa8f96c:6

value
1314000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b76b6dc8e873b7bcb0facb1a7a416a24f236d02 OP_EQUAL
address
3EQS4d4XRcW3wDT9Yo9KA3VXYv91AbRjPK
transaction
30156c6f8aa69438d4c9c0913834b5977e89694e50e7215b8cbdd6549fa8f96c
spent
true